The shade or shadow of a building influences smoke movement. True or False?

The statement that the shade or shadow of a building influences smoke movement is true. Smoke behavior is significantly affected by environmental factors, including structures that can create variations in airflow. Buildings can block sunlight and modify temperature gradients, which may impact the buoyancy of smoke. Warmer air rises, while cooler air tends to settle closer to the ground; thus, when buildings cast shadows, it can lead to cooler temperatures around them. This cooling effect can have a direct impact on how smoke disperses and flows, potentially causing it to linger or move in unpredictable ways.

In addition, obstacles like buildings create changes in wind patterns. When wind encounters a structure, it can cause turbulence and eddies, further influencing how smoke travels. This understanding is crucial for fire safety and management, as effective planning and response strategies must consider these dynamics in smoke movement to protect life and property during a fire event.
